From cb093f29b61be1391bb1e39e7480d4af7a169685 Mon Sep 17 00:00:00 2001 From: David Barbet Date: Tue, 6 Jun 2023 15:49:05 -0700 Subject: [PATCH] Fix helixApiAccessToken parameter when none is available --- eng/pipelines/test-unix-job.yml | 5 ++++- eng/pipelines/test-windows-job.yml | 5 ++++-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/eng/pipelines/test-unix-job.yml b/eng/pipelines/test-unix-job.yml index b4bdddc576c74..6a2a05b83c2dc 100644 --- a/eng/pipelines/test-unix-job.yml +++ b/eng/pipelines/test-unix-job.yml @@ -48,7 +48,10 @@ jobs: - task: ShellScript@2 inputs: scriptPath: ./eng/build.sh - args: --ci --helix --configuration ${{ parameters.configuration }} --helixQueueName ${{ parameters.helixQueueName }} --helixApiAccessToken ${{ parameters.helixApiAccessToken }} ${{ parameters.testArguments }} + ${{ if eq(parameters.helixApiAccessToken, '') }}: + args: --ci --helix --configuration ${{ parameters.configuration }} --helixQueueName ${{ parameters.helixQueueName }} ${{ parameters.testArguments }} + ${{ else }}: + args: --ci --helix --configuration ${{ parameters.configuration }} --helixQueueName ${{ parameters.helixQueueName }} --helixApiAccessToken ${{ parameters.helixApiAccessToken }} ${{ parameters.testArguments }} displayName: Test env: SYSTEM_ACCESSTOKEN: $(System.AccessToken) diff --git a/eng/pipelines/test-windows-job.yml b/eng/pipelines/test-windows-job.yml index 6d4daba320b50..075edc33f5a15 100644 --- a/eng/pipelines/test-windows-job.yml +++ b/eng/pipelines/test-windows-job.yml @@ -49,7 +49,10 @@ jobs: displayName: Run Unit Tests inputs: filePath: eng/build.ps1 - arguments: -ci -helix -configuration ${{ parameters.configuration }} -helixQueueName ${{ parameters.helixQueueName }} -helixApiAccessToken ${{ parameters.helixApiAccessToken }} ${{ parameters.testArguments }} -collectDumps + ${{ if eq(parameters.helixApiAccessToken, '') }}: + arguments: -ci -helix -configuration ${{ parameters.configuration }} -helixQueueName ${{ parameters.helixQueueName }} ${{ parameters.testArguments }} -collectDumps + ${{ else }}: + arguments: -ci -helix -configuration ${{ parameters.configuration }} -helixQueueName ${{ parameters.helixQueueName }} -helixApiAccessToken ${{ parameters.helixApiAccessToken }} ${{ parameters.testArguments }} -collectDumps env: SYSTEM_ACCESSTOKEN: $(System.AccessToken)